We need volunteers! We are a large Lodge, nearly 2,400 strong. When you become an Elk, it is suggested you offer 12 volunteer hours each year to any of the many events and causes where we give service. What you may not know is that these hours are reported to the National Elks, and with our volunteer hours our Lodge is acknowledged and awarded opportunities to apply for a variety of grants and scholarships. The monies that are awarded stay in our community!
